STEOL® CS-230 PCK

Supplied byStepan Company- Last Updated on Apr 2, 2026

Sodium Laureth Sulfate. STEOL® CS-230 PCK by Stepan Company is an anionic surfactant, foam booster providing good foaming and viscosity response. It is a low active, 2-mole sodium laureth sulfate preserved with CIT/MIT. It is derived from fatty alcohols, ethoxylated to an average of two moles, and sulfated via Stepan's continuous SO3 process.
  • It is compatible with commonly used opacifying and pearlizing agents.
  • It is bio-based, biodegradable and naturally derived.
  • Provides flexibility, improved mildness and low irritation properties.
  • It can be easily formulated for mild cleansing products, shampoo, body wash, baby-, bath product and hand soap applications.
  • STEOL® CS-230 PCK is kosher certified.
